从Resources文件夹中删除CoreDataBooks.sqlite后,它是如何继续生成的?

时间:2011-10-22 14:35:06

标签: ios core-data

如果我从iPhone模拟器和Resources文件夹中删除CoreDataBooks.sqlite,为什么它会再次在Iphone模拟器中生成所有书籍数据?我显然希望在发布时创建一个空的CoreDataBooks.sqlite。

我在这里缺少什么?

注意:此问题涉及名为“ CoreDataBooks ”的Apple示例项目。

1 个答案:

答案 0 :(得分:0)

您可能会发现CoreDataBooks.sqlite文件仍在构建输出中。即使您从源代码树中删除该文件,并从模拟器中删除该应用程序,下次运行该应用程序时,它也将从您的构建输出中安装。

尝试打开“产品”菜单,按“选项”并选择 清洁构建文件夹... 。这应该删除任何以前生成的构建输出,然后您可以在没有CoreDataBooks.sqlite文件的情况下重建应用程序。